So now that we know Drew guessed correctly to win the blockbuster, after only seeing two of the clues..
Would it be a crazy strategy to just hit a button as soon as the completion starts?
If you randomly choose a button at the start, you have a 33% chance of winning. Obviously a gamble, but it is also a gamble to play the competition and risk someone else hitting the correct answer before you can get to it, making your chance of winning 0.
It is an interesting wrinkle that once an option is chosen it cannot be chosen by another houseguest.
As we were watching last night, as soon as the competition started I said “I’m taking the gamble and hitting a button now.”
Thoughts on this strategy??
